Jenna Ortega, popular for her role in the Netflix original show Wednesday, has found herself in the crossfire of the ongoing Writers Guild of America (WGA) strike. The strike is against the network and production studios, but some writers have decided to target Ortega for her controversial comments on the writing decisions of the show.

During an interview on the Armchair Expert podcast earlier this year, Ortega spoke about her experience working on the show and admitted to making changes to the script without consulting the show’s writers. She also criticized certain plot developments and dialogues, claiming they did not make sense for her character. Her comments added fuel to the fire during the ongoing WGA strike.

Following her comments, some writers decided to troll Ortega on social media, mocking her claims of rewriting parts of the show to make it better. Some fans have backed the writers’ strike, recognizing their importance in making their favorite shows and movies. However, some users have criticized the writers for being misogynistic, though it remains unclear if this is the case.
